Real-time simulator for power system dynamics studies

Journal Article · · IEEE Transactions on Power Systems
DOI:https://doi.org/10.1109/59.387952· OSTI ID:82711

The addition of dynamic models of loads, machines and sub-transmission networks to the existing three-phase real-time simulator of Hydro-Quebec (IREQ), has made available a tool appropriate for the study of power system dynamics in real time. The valid frequency range of the simulator, which already covered harmonics up to 2,000 Hz, has been extended to include machine dynamics in the region of less than 1 Hz. The paper describes the modules added and also presents some results of the integration of these dynamic models, showing how they compare favorably with equivalent results obtained using a transient stability simulation program.
